我只注意到未添加到混帳我創建的文件(的.cs,的.xaml等),所以我提交+推不會上傳他們到存儲庫。我知道我可以去終端,並做git add path/to/file
,但我想知道如何從Visual Studio內做到這一點。問題與Visual Studio 2013社區和Git
我試過右鍵單擊該文件並搜索添加到源文件控制但該選項未列出。我該怎麼辦?
我已經看着它,但每一個微軟的文檔是團隊基礎,它不適合我
我只注意到未添加到混帳我創建的文件(的.cs,的.xaml等),所以我提交+推不會上傳他們到存儲庫。我知道我可以去終端,並做git add path/to/file
,但我想知道如何從Visual Studio內做到這一點。問題與Visual Studio 2013社區和Git
我試過右鍵單擊該文件並搜索添加到源文件控制但該選項未列出。我該怎麼辦?
我已經看着它,但每一個微軟的文檔是團隊基礎,它不適合我
確保微軟的Git提供商被選擇作爲源代碼控制插件(假設的Visual Studio 2013)工作:
鎖應該出現在你的文件旁邊(假設你的項目是一個git倉庫),你應該可以添加你的文件。
參考:https://msdn.microsoft.com/en-us/library/axafab5c(v=vs.90).aspx
編輯:既然你已經有了你的插件設置正確,你可能只需要執行提交。我不相信Visual Studio有一個獨立的界面來分級更改;當您提交時,它應該將您的新文件列爲「包含的更改」,並且該文件在解決方案資源管理器中應該在其旁邊具有綠色加號。
任何未提交的文件都應列在下方的「排除更改」或「未跟蹤文件」下。您可以將單個文件添加到此處的提交中。
如果你的文件缺少綠色加號,我會檢查你的.gitignore文件以確保它不被忽略。
問題是,在某些文件中,藍色的小鎖不存在。並在其上單擊鼠標右鍵並沒有顯示將它們添加到源代碼控制 – 2015-01-20 22:34:55
@ChristopherFrancisco檢查我的編輯相關的任何事情,你可能只需要提交併應列出它作爲一個包括改變。我剛剛在自己的項目上進行了驗證。 – 2015-01-20 22:37:34
「包含更改」,解決了它。有沒有辦法自動添加新創建的文件git,而不必手動去那裏? – 2015-01-20 22:38:51
我假設你已經閱讀http://www.bing.com/search?q=visual+studio+integration+vs+git和這個結果http://stackoverflow.com/questions/507343/using- git-with-visual-studio尤其已經...所以請澄清你還在尋找什麼。 – 2015-01-20 22:30:43